A formal cursive script with a pronounced rightward slant and flowing, continuous stroke motion. Letterforms show sharp contrast between hairline upstrokes and heavier downstrokes, with tapered terminals and frequent entry/exit strokes that encourage joining. Capitals are prominent and decorative, featuring generous loops, curls, and occasional extended swashes, while the lowercase maintains a consistent rhythmic bounce with compact counters and narrow joins. Numerals echo the calligraphic treatment, mixing open curves and delicate hairlines for a cohesive, handwritten look.

The design relies on fine hairlines and delicate connections, so clarity and texture are strongest at moderate-to-large sizes where the contrast and swashes can breathe. Several letters feature long lead-in/lead-out strokes that add flourish and can create lively word shapes, especially in headline settings.
